Navigating Planning Permissions in County Monaghan
Obtaining planning permission is a crucial but often complex step in the building process. The regulations in County Monaghan, specifically those regarding log cabin construction, must be adhered to. Begin by thoroughly researching the local council’s planning guidelines, and submitting a planning application package to the local planning authority. This package will typically include detailed site plans, elevations, and other relevant documentation. Consult with a planning consultant specializing in the County Monaghan area to navigate this process efficiently and increase the likelihood of approval. Their expertise can help you avoid common pitfalls and ensure your application meets all the necessary requirements.
Understanding the types of developments exempt from requiring planning permission is also beneficial. Certain smaller extensions or renovations might not need full planning approval, but it’s crucial to confirm this with the council. Always err on the side of caution and seek professional advice if you are unsure. Delays in planning permission can be time-consuming and costly, so prepare your application meticulously, and stay informed of any changes to planning regulations. When viewing potential log cabins, carefully inspect the structure and assess its condition. Pay close attention to the timber’s condition, looking for signs of rot, insect infestation, or other damage. Check for any leaks or water damage, and assess the roof’s condition. Consider hiring a building surveyor to conduct a comprehensive inspection, as they can identify potential problems that may not be immediately obvious. Ensure the log cabin meets your needs in terms of size, layout, and amenities. This thorough inspection will help you make an informed decision and avoid costly repairs down the line.

Maintaining Your Log Cabin: Ensuring Longevity and Beauty
Proper maintenance is essential to preserving the beauty and extending the lifespan of your log cabin. Regular inspection and maintenance can prevent major problems down the line. Regularly inspect the exterior of your log cabin for any signs of damage, such as cracks, splits, or insect infestations. Check the roof for leaks, and ensure the gutters and downspouts are clear of debris. Keeping a close eye on these areas will help to address issues before they escalate. Consider professional inspection to maintain your property’s value.
Protecting the timber from the elements is critical. Apply a high-quality sealant or stain to the exterior logs to protect them from moisture, UV rays, and other environmental factors. Reapply the sealant or stain as recommended by the manufacturer. Consider using a weather-resistant wood treatment that protects the timber from decay, insect damage, and mildew. Regularly cleaning the exterior of your log cabin will also help to maintain its appearance and prevent the buildup of dirt and grime. Protecting the logs will make your home a joy to inhabit for many years to come.
Inside the cabin, regular maintenance will keep your retreat in great condition. Properly ventilate the cabin, particularly in areas prone to moisture. Avoid placing furniture directly against exterior walls to allow for air circulation and prevent moisture buildup. Regularly clean and maintain your windows and doors. Be sure to address any issues promptly to prevent further damage. The result will be a cozy and inviting space for years to come.
